In loving memory of Terrance Leon
Terrance Leon lived a life marked by struggle, perseverance, and compassion. Though he battled with addiction, he never gave up. He walked the streets and sought recovery many time, always striving for something better. Even in his own pain, Terrance ministered to others, loving and encouraging them because he understood their suffering firsthand. God allowed us to experience life with Terrance so that through him, we could learn compassion, understanding, and how to help others who walk a similar path. His life reminds us that purpose can exist even in hardship, and that love can be shared even in broken places. Terrance will be remembered for his heart, his resilience, and his desire to help others feel seen and understood.
Our mission is God’s plan. We also dedicate this work to Terrance, who struggled with addiction and was often unable to stay home. Though we tried and loved him deeply, the battle was greater than us. Only God could reach him in the depths of that struggle. God took him home to heal him and give him rest. In his memory, we vow to go out and show others that God believes they are worth finding, worth loving, and never forgotten.
January 22, 1990-August 18, 2023
